HCRM博客

如何有效获取验证码?

验证码是一种用于验证用户身份或防止自动化攻击的安全机制,广泛应用于各种在线服务中,获取验证码的方式有多种,具体取决于应用场景和用户需求,以下是几种常见的获取验证码的方法:

1、通过短信接收验证码

如何有效获取验证码?-图1
(图片来源网络,侵权删除)

使用个人手机卡:这是最常见的方法,用户在注册或登录时输入手机号码,系统会发送验证码到该手机上,这种方法简单直接,但需要确保手机卡在身边且能够接收短信。

借用他人手机:如果自己的手机卡不在身边,可以借用朋友的手机接收验证码,这种方法需要信任的朋友协助。

网络电话:使用网络电话服务(如微信电话本、有信等)拨打运营商客服电话,通过网络电话接收验证码,这种方式适用于手机卡丢失或无法使用的情况。

前往运营商营业厅:如果以上方法都不可行,可以直接前往运营商营业厅补办新卡,这种方法虽然繁琐,但最为可靠。

2、通过电子邮件接收验证码

注册邮箱:用户在注册或登录时输入电子邮件地址,系统会发送验证码到该邮箱,这种方法适用于没有手机或手机无法接收短信的情况。

如何有效获取验证码?-图2
(图片来源网络,侵权删除)

备用邮箱:用户可以在账户设置中添加备用邮箱,以便在主邮箱无法使用时接收验证码。

3、通过第三方验证器应用

验证器应用:如Microsoft Authenticator等应用,可以提供更轻松的验证方式,即使验证设备处于脱机状态也能登录,这种方法适用于经常需要验证的用户。

生物识别:一些服务支持使用人脸、指纹或设备PIN进行验证,这种方式更加安全便捷。

4、通过接码平台

临时手机号:一些平台提供临时手机号接收验证码的服务,这种方法适用于不想泄露真实手机号码的用户。

如何有效获取验证码?-图3
(图片来源网络,侵权删除)

注意事项:使用临时手机号时,需注意不要用于接收财务相关信息,以免造成损失。

5、通过图形验证码

图形验证码:通过图片展示验证码,用户需要识别图片中的字符并输入到表单中,这种方式常用于防止自动化脚本攻击。

实现方式:后端生成验证码图片,前端展示给用户,用户输入后前端将输入的验证码发送到后端进行验证。

6、通过第三方验证码服务

Google reCAPTCHA:通过分析用户行为来判断是否为机器人,这种方式不仅提高了安全性,还减少了用户的输入负担。

集成步骤:在官网注册并获取API密钥,在前端页面中引入JavaScript库,在表单中添加组件,并在提交时验证响应。

7、通过语音验证码

语音电话:系统通过语音电话播报验证码,用户输入听到的验证码进行验证,这种方式适用于听力正常的用户。

注意事项:确保在安静的环境中接听电话,以免听错验证码。

8、通过安全问题验证

安全问题:用户在注册时设置安全问题,验证时回答这些问题以证明身份,这种方式适用于没有其他验证手段的情况。

实现方式:在账户设置中添加安全问题,并在验证时回答这些问题。

在使用这些获取验证码的方法时,以下几点需要特别注意:

保护个人信息:不要随意泄露手机号码、电子邮件地址等个人信息,以免遭受诈骗或骚扰。

及时更新联系方式:确保账户上的联系方式是最新的,避免因更换工作或学校电子邮件地址而无法接收验证码。

防范钓鱼网站:不要在不可信的网站上输入验证码,以免信息被盗取。

备份验证方式:在账户设置中添加多种验证方式,如备用邮箱或第三方验证器应用,以便在一种方式不可用时使用其他方式。

获取验证码的方法多种多样,每种方法都有其适用的场景和优缺点,用户可以根据自己的需求和实际情况选择合适的方法,并在使用过程中注意保护个人信息和账户安全。

本站部分图片及内容来源网络,版权归原作者所有,转载目的为传递知识,不代表本站立场。若侵权或违规联系Email:zjx77377423@163.com 核实后第一时间删除。 转载请注明出处:https://blog.huochengrm.cn/ask/20824.html

分享:
扫描分享到社交APP
上一篇
下一篇